Key Responsibilities

The key responsibilities of a Nursing Associate in Central and North West London NHS Trust show how you can help the Trust deliver safe, effective services and providing patients and families with a positive experience.

  • Be accountable for your practice to a registered nurse
  • Participate in regular supervision with that registered nurse
  • Supervise, help training and delegate to other members of the team e.g. Health Care Assistants
  • Participate in team meetings and help develop the team
  • Contributing to creating and maintaining a high performing team by:
    • communicating well with all members of the team
    • understanding how your role helps the team achieve its objective
    • understanding the roles of different team members and how they help the team achieve its’ objectives
    • using supervision and team meetings to reflect on your own practice regularly
  • Develop skills in relation to coaching/teaching individuals/carers/other staff
  • Engage in reflective practice including management of self and reflection on own reactions, asking questions and reflecting on answers given
Work to Improve Safety and the Quality of Care

As a Nursing Associate you will contribute to the provision of safe and high quality services by:

  • Working to the standards set out in the NMC Code for Nurses, Midwives and Nursing Associates
  • Recognise issues relating to safeguarding vulnerable children and adults and report any problems or raise concerns to the appropriate registered care professionals (including raising a safeguarding alert)
  • Escalating safety concerns (including completing Datix) and by doing so acting as effective advocates for those who use our services
  • Maintaining your competences and proficiencies in all the required areas for your role
  • Maintaining compliance with your mandatory training requirements
  • Working to the limit of your role but being clear not to work beyond your remit or scope of competency
  • Understanding how you are accountable to registered nurses
  • Identifying areas where improvements in safety or quality can be made and working closely with others to improve services
  • Being open and transparent
  • Maintaining accurate, legible, timely and comprehensive records
  • Assist in the assessment of and contribute to the management of risk across several areas within the environment where care is being administered
Provide and Monitor Care

Nursing Associates have a set of skills which enables you to provide and monitor care across most health and social care settings. You will be expected to:

  • Develop understanding of all elements of the nursing process and be able to assist the registered nurse in the on‑going assessment, planning, management and evaluation of care.
  • Assist in the delivery of complex care as prescribed by the registered nurse
  • Contribute to the assessment of care
  • Working with patients and registered nurses to develop and implement care plans within the scope of your competence
  • Providing skilled, evidence based care which adheres to agreed policies and procedures
  • Take responsibility for monitoring and evaluation of care
  • Ensure the privacy, dignity and safety of individuals is maintained at all times
  • Demonstrate the ability to recognise changing priorities seeking advice and guidance from the Registered Nurse or other registered care professionals as appropriate
  • Report back and share information with the registered nurses on the condition, behaviour, activity and responses of individuals
  • Recognise deterioration in patients and elevate concerns appropriately
  • Demonstrate good understanding of principles of consent and ensure valid consent is obtained prior to undertaking nursing and care procedures
  • Act as patient advocates in the multi‑disciplinary team.
  • Referring to other teams or services as appropriate.
  • Develop a working knowledge of other providers’ resources and referral systems to ensure individual’s needs are met, within parameters of practice
Promote Health and Prevent Ill Health
  • Working in partnership with patients and their families and carers
  • Acting as a role model for health care assistants and registered staff in working closely with people using our services
  • Gaining consent and, as far as possible, involving people in all decision making
  • Signposting patients and carers to supportive services
  • Reassuring people by being professional, responsive, knowledgeable and confident
  • Escalating complaints or concerns effectively and quickly in line with the Trust policy
